Nowadays, employers often use phone interviews early in the hiring process to learn more about you and your experience.
Think of ways how you are going to have to impress the company over the telephone lines. This can seem like a strong barrier to overcome but in reality, with the right approach, phone interviews can be seen as an advantage to interviewees.
Performing well on a phone interview can help you land the job you want. As unemployment grows, more companies are using phone interviews to screen large pools of qualified candidates.
